Zoe the Puffy kitten recovers at Palm Springs Animal Shelter
A kitten treated at the Palm Springs Animal Shelter for a reported damaged windpipe that caused her appearance to resemble a balloon was healing Thursday and might be available for adoption after herrecovery. Zoe the kitten arrived at the shelter about a week ago for having too much air trapped under the skin, otherwise known as subcutaneous emphysema, which made...
